Protokoll #17726

ID17726
Zeitstempel2025-12-26 18:08:28.644454
Clientroot
IP145.224.72.140
Modellclaude-sonnet-4-20250514
Statuscompleted
Tokens1,142 (Input: 49, Output: 1,093)
Dauer365 ms
Request-Zeit2025-12-26 18:08:28.644454
Response-Zeit2025-12-26 18:08:29.009824

Request

{
    "event": "PreToolUse",
    "tool_name": "Grep",
    "tool_input": {
        "pattern": "Parsedown|markdown|->content",
        "path": "\/var\/www\/dev.campus.systemische-tools.de\/src",
        "output_mode": "content",
        "-n": true
    }
}

Response

{
    "tool_response": {
        "mode": "content",
        "numFiles": 0,
        "filenames": [],
        "content": "\/var\/www\/dev.campus.systemische-tools.de\/src\/Controller\/ChatController.php:206:        $format = $this->getString('format') ?: 'markdown';\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Controller\/ChatController.php:225:            $this->download($content, $filename, 'text\/markdown');\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Controller\/PromptsController.php:66:            content: $command->content,\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Controller\/PromptsController.php:125:            content: $command->content,\n\/var\/www\/dev.campus.systemische-tools.de\/src\/UseCases\/Content\/ContentGenerationResult.php:21:        return $this->content;\n\/var\/www\/dev.campus.systemische-tools.de\/src\/UseCases\/Content\/ContentGenerationResult.php:79:            'content' => $this->content,\n\/var\/www\/dev.campus.systemische-tools.de\/src\/UseCases\/Config\/ConfigDTO.php:47:        $decoded = json_decode($this->content, true);\n\/var\/www\/dev.campus.systemische-tools.de\/src\/UseCases\/Config\/ConfigDTO.php:60:            'content' => $this->content,\n\/var\/www\/dev.campus.systemische-tools.de\/src\/UseCases\/Command\/CreatePromptCommand.php:47:        if ($this->content === '') {\n\/var\/www\/dev.campus.systemische-tools.de\/src\/UseCases\/Command\/UpdatePromptCommand.php:53:        if ($this->content === '') {\n\/var\/www\/dev.campus.systemische-tools.de\/src\/UseCases\/Prompts\/PromptDTO.php:43:            'content' => $this->content,\n\/var\/www\/dev.campus.systemische-tools.de\/src\/UseCases\/Chat\/ExportChatSessionUseCase.php:46:                $md .= $msg->content()->value() . \"\\n\\n\";\n\/var\/www\/dev.campus.systemische-tools.de\/src\/UseCases\/Chat\/ExportChatSessionUseCase.php:49:                $md .= $msg->content()->value() . \"\\n\\n\";\n\/var\/www\/dev.campus.systemische-tools.de\/src\/UseCases\/Chat\/ExportChatSessionUseCase.php:93:                'content' => $msg->content()->value(),\n\/var\/www\/dev.campus.systemische-tools.de\/src\/View\/chat\/index.php:71:                            <a href=\"\/chat\/<?= $session['uuid'] ?? '' ?>\/export?format=markdown\" class=\"dropdown-item\">Markdown (.md)<\/a>\n\/var\/www\/dev.campus.systemische-tools.de\/src\/View\/chat\/partials\/message.php:6: * @var bool $formatContent Whether to apply markdown formatting (default: true for assistant)\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/Entity\/ChatMessage.php:47:        $this->content = $content;\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/Entity\/ChatMessage.php:167:        return $this->content;\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/Entity\/ChatMessage.php:285:            'content' => $this->content->value(),\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/Entity\/TaskComment.php:53:        return $this->content;\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/Entity\/TaskComment.php:104:        $this->content = $content;\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/Entity\/TaskComment.php:131:            'content' => $this->content,\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/DTO\/ContentVersionDTO.php:73:        if (mb_strlen($this->content) <= $length) {\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/DTO\/ContentVersionDTO.php:74:            return $this->content;\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/DTO\/ContentVersionDTO.php:77:        return mb_substr($this->content, 0, $length) . '...';\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/DTO\/QdrantSearchResultDTO.php:95:        if (mb_strlen($this->content) <= $length) {\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/DTO\/QdrantSearchResultDTO.php:96:            return $this->content;\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Domain\/DTO\/QdrantSearchResultDTO.php:99:        return mb_substr($this->content, 0, $length) . '...';\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Infrastructure\/Docs\/ChunkAnalyzer.php:117:        \/\/ Extract JSON from response (handle markdown code blocks)\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Infrastructure\/AI\/AIResponse.php:31:        $this->content = $content;\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Infrastructure\/AI\/AIResponse.php:81:        return $this->content;\n\/var\/www\/dev.campus.systemische-tools.de\/src\/Infrastructure\/AI\/AIResponse.php:127:            'content' => $this->content,",
        "numLines": 32
    }
}
← Vorheriger Zur Liste Nächster →